OverviewA signed contract. A twelve-week deadline. And a billionaire who thinks he can buy everything-except her heart. Laurel Payne is one overdue bill away from losing everything. A struggling artist in Providence, she's drowning in debt and exhausted from survival mode. So when a lawyer offers her a meeting with the elusive Bartholomew Rogers, she expects a commission. Instead, she gets a proposal that sounds like madness. Bartholomew is a man controlled by a legacy he can't escape. To save his family's foundation from a predatory trustee, he needs two things: a wife to prove his stability, and an heir to satisfy a ruthless trust clause. He has money, power, and a plan. What he doesn't have is time. The terms are simple: Marry him. Move into his cliffside Newport estate. Produce an heir within a strict twelve-week window. Walk away with $700,000 and her life back. It should be a cold business transaction. But Laurel isn't the pliable accessory Bartholomew expected. She demands boundaries. She creates rules. And in a house echoing with secrets and sea storms, she forces the controlled billionaire to feel things he's spent a lifetime suppressing. But when their private arrangement is leaked by a vengeful enemy, the world labels their marriage a sham. With the trust fund on the line and a baby on the way, Bartholomew must decide what he is willing to sacrifice. Will he fight for the money that defines him? Or will he burn his legacy to the ground to protect the woman who taught him that love isn't a line item? The Trust Fund Bride is a steamy, high-stakes contemporary romance featuring a grumpy billionaire, a marriage of convenience, and a pregnancy contract that turns into real love. No cheating, no cliffhangers, and a hard-won HEA.
